    11/22 Minus stars if I could: To finish the review, I have to report that during my family members stay here in August, he contracted sepsis. I had to get a Power of Attorney to get him out and back to the hospital. After a week stay at the hospital he was moved him to another skilled nursing facility (I will review them shortly) where he stayed for 2 more weeks. It's a good thing I acquired the POA and was able to take charge. I'd hate to think the outcome if I would have just left him to the care of this facility. If you choose this facility, you must go everyday to make sure they're being taken care of.

    I started Physical Therapy at PRN La Mesa in March, because after spinal cord surgery last year,…read morethe finger tips in my right hand were completely numb with no tactile sensation. The Neurosurgeon wanted to do more surgery to try and relive the symptoms. A nerve conductive study gave a diagnosis of Carpal Tunnel. I asked for a referral to PT before considering another surgery. At 74, surgery risks increase. My Physical therapist was Pablo Pelayo. After my initial interview, we both agreed that my symptoms were not typical of Carpal Tunnel. After 5 visits, I was elated to find I was getting sensation back in my fingers. This was HUGE!!. After more than a year I finally got sensation back, without surgery. Pablo's approach was phenomenal.We continued to work for a total of 16 visits. Now I have 75-80% feeling and tactile sensation back. I could not be more appreciative or grateful for having the full use of my right hand again. Pablo and the entire staff at PRN La Mesa, treat all their patients with dignity, respect and genuine concern for getting the best possible results.
